Q: How can fruits help me feel full and satisfied, making it easier to stick to a calorie-controlled diet for weight loss?

A: The magic of fruits in promoting fullness lies primarily in their high fiber and water content. When you eat a juicy apple or a handful of berries, the fiber expands in your stomach, signaling to your brain that you're full. This sensation of satiety helps prevent overeating and reduces the urge to snack on less healthy options. Furthermore, the natural sugars in fruits are accompanied by fiber, which slows down their absorption, preventing the sharp blood sugar spikes and crashes that often lead to increased hunger. This is a stark contrast to refined sugars found in many processed foods, which offer a quick energy rush followed by a rapid drop, leaving you feeling hungry again shortly after. For those of us living in the UAE, where the climate can be dehydrating, the high water content of fruits like watermelon, oranges, and strawberries also contributes to hydration, which itself can often be mistaken for hunger. By choosing fresh fruit Dubai, you're not just getting delicious flavor; you're getting a powerful tool to manage your appetite and maintain a consistent calorie deficit necessary for sustainable weight loss.

Q: Are all fruits equally good for weight loss, or should I be mindful of certain types, especially considering the varied fresh fruit UAE options?

A: While all fruits offer nutritional benefits, when it comes to weight loss, some are certainly more beneficial than others due to their calorie density and sugar content. The general rule of thumb is to prioritize fruits with higher fiber and water content and lower glycemic index. Berries (strawberries, blueberries, raspberries), apples, pears, oranges, grapefruit, and kiwi are excellent choices. They are packed with fiber, antioxidants, and a moderate amount of natural sugars. Fruits like watermelon and cantaloupe are also fantastic due to their high water content, making them very filling for fewer calories. However, fruits like mangoes, bananas, and dates, while incredibly nutritious and a staple in our region, are higher in natural sugars and calories. This doesn't mean you should avoid them entirely! It simply means portion control is key. A small banana or a few dates can be a great energy booster, especially pre- or post-workout, but consuming them in large quantities might hinder your weight loss progress. The diverse range of fresh fruit UAE offers a fantastic opportunity to explore and find your favorites, but always be mindful of portion sizes, especially for the sweeter varieties. Balance is always the answer!

Q: Can fruit juice be a substitute for whole fruits when I'm trying to lose weight, especially for fruit nutrition?

A: This is a common question, and the answer is generally no, especially when your primary goal is weight loss. While fruit juice does contain vitamins and minerals, it lacks the crucial fiber found in whole fruits. When fruits are juiced, the fiber is often removed, which means the natural sugars are absorbed much more quickly by your body. This can lead to a rapid spike in blood sugar, followed by a crash, leaving you feeling hungry again sooner. Furthermore, it's very easy to consume a large number of calories from juice without realizing it. For example, it might take several oranges to make one glass of orange juice, but you wouldn't typically eat that many oranges in one sitting. For optimal fruit nutrition and satiety, always opt for whole fresh fruit UAE. If you occasionally enjoy a small glass of 100% freshly squeezed juice, make sure it's in moderation and consider diluting it with water. Better yet, make a smoothie where the whole fruit, including its fiber, is incorporated.

Q: What are some common misconceptions about fruits and weight loss that I should be aware of while following Dr. Khan's Rule 20?

A: It's important to clear up some common misconceptions to maximize the benefits of Dr. Khan's Rule 20: "Fruits" for weight loss.

  • "Fruits are too high in sugar to lose weight": While fruits do contain natural sugars (fructose), this sugar comes packaged with fiber, water, vitamins, and antioxidants. The fiber slows down sugar absorption, preventing rapid blood sugar spikes. The problem lies with added sugars in processed foods, not the natural sugars in whole fruits.
  • "I can eat unlimited amounts of fruit": Even healthy foods need to be consumed in moderation. While fruits are excellent, they still contain calories. Overeating even healthy fruits can lead to consuming too many calories, hindering weight loss. Portion control, especially for higher-sugar fruits, is key.
  • "All fruits are the same for weight loss": As discussed earlier, some fruits are more calorie-dense or higher in sugar than others. While all fruits are nutritious, prioritizing lower-glycemic, high-fiber options like berries and apples can be more effective for weight management.
  • "Fruit can replace vegetables": While fruits are wonderful, they don't replace the unique nutritional profile of vegetables. A balanced diet includes both an abundance of vegetables and a healthy intake of fruits.
